One of the common problems after double-eyelid surgery is asymmetry of the eye line. This can occur when the size or shape of the eyes is asymmetric, when the height of the double-eyelid lines does not match, or when the thickness is uneven. These issues not only cause dissatisfaction with appearance, but can also create psychological stress for patients whenever they look in the mirror in daily life. In addition to these cosmetic concerns, functional problems may also occur after surgery. For example, the eyelids may not function properly, affecting vision, or the patient may have difficulty closing the eyes completely. It is important to analyze the problems that occurred during the first surgery and establish an appropriate revision surgery plan. To determine the proper timing for revision surgery, the recovery period, scar condition, and tissue stability must be carefully checked, so the judgment of an experienced medical team is necessary.
When revision surgery is performed at a clinic skilled in double-eyelid revision surgery, a customized surgical plan should be established after carefully analyzing the individual’s facial structure and skin condition. Every patient’s face is different, and each person has different eye size, skin thickness, and eye muscle condition, so the same surgical method cannot be applied uniformly to all patients. For example, when designing the double-eyelid line, skin elasticity and thickness, as well as the distribution of subcutaneous fat, must be considered comprehensively to achieve the most natural and harmonious result. In addition, canthoplasty is often performed together after double-eyelid surgery. Canthoplasty helps make the eyes appear larger and more attractive by increasing the horizontal length of the eyes or improving the vertical openness. This can be performed additionally after basic double-eyelid surgery using the non-incisional buried suture method or the incisional method. At a clinic skilled in double-eyelid revision surgery, various methods such as epicanthoplasty, lateral canthoplasty, and lower canthoplasty are combined according to the patient’s eye condition and desired result, providing a more effective and three-dimensional change. Canthoplasty is generally suitable for patients who want a clearer and more definite change, and it can produce a more noticeable effect for those with smaller eyes.
